Topic Overview

Intraoperative discovery of vaginal agenesis during posterior sagittal anorectoplasty for a female infant with anorectal malformation (perineal fistula). The surgical team identified absent vaginal lumen despite normal external appearance, prompting diagnostic laparoscopy that revealed a rudimentary upper vagina, uterus, fallopian tubes, and ovaries but no cervix initially apparent. After multidisciplinary consultation, the team proceeded with rectal pull-through and sigmoid colon neovagina creation (7-8 cm segment), connecting the neovagina to the rudimentary upper vaginal structure based on intraoperative assessment suggesting possible cervical tissue. The case illustrates management of rare Müllerian anomaly (approximately 40 cases in presenter's experience, representing unexpected finding in ~1/500 perineal fistula repairs).

Key Takeaways

  • Vaginal agenesis in perineal fistula is rare (~1/500 cases); MRI has limited utility in infants without hydrocolpos. (44:03)
  • Create neovagina during initial rectal repair to avoid operating through scarred perineum; sigmoid preferred over small bowel. (48:12)
  • Retaining uterus without cervix offers no proven fertility benefit and risks pyometra; no live births reported from such cases. (44:03)
  • Tack neovagina to pelvic fascia or posterior bladder to prevent prolapse; remove staple line to avoid foreign material. (49:17)
  • Perform pelvic ultrasound and vaginoscopy after breast budding to reassess Müllerian structures; dilation not routinely needed. (1:09:37)

Points of disagreement

  • 21:46Whether to create neovagina immediately or defer to later surgery
    • Dan Teitelbaum: Create neovagina now using sigmoid colon; this is favorable anatomy with good perineum
    • Mark Levitt: Neovagina would not be addressed for 15-20 years if deferred, creating significant scar tissue; optimal timing is now during rectal mobilization
  • 23:22Which bowel segment to use for neovagina
    • Dan Teitelbaum: Use distal rectum as anus given good anatomy; use sigmoid for neovagina
    • Don: Rectum should remain as rectum for continence; sigmoid does not have same storage and physiologic properties as rectum
  • 44:03Management of uterus without apparent cervix
    • Don: In absence of cervix, no evidence retaining uterus is beneficial for fertility; risks pyometra if connected to outflow tract
    • Mark Levitt: Leave uterine structures intact given possibility of future uterine transplant technology; can remove laparoscopically later if complications arise
  • 50:59Whether to connect neovagina to rudimentary upper vagina
    • Don: Do not connect or remove anything until family discussion complete
    • Mark Levitt: After identifying possible cervical tissue on tactile examination, proceed with connection; worst case is removal if infection develops

Presentation

A female infant presented with what appeared to be a straightforward anorectal malformation — a perineal fistula with externally normal-appearing genitalia. Neonatal pelvic ultrasound showed no hydrocolpos 4:25. Renal and urologic workup returned normal 12:11. The sacral anatomy suggested favorable prognosis for future continence 25:36. The surgical plan was posterior sagittal anorectoplasty, a well-rehearsed operation for this anatomy.

At the start of the case, the surgeon attempted to pass a catheter through what looked like a normal hymen. No lumen was found. "There's no vagina here," he said. "Isn't that incredible? It looks very, very normal" [q1]. The urethra was enlarged, typical for anorectal malformations with absent vagina 5:49, but where the vaginal opening should have been, there was only tissue.

The Decision Point

The rectum had been mobilized through the posterior sagittal approach. The dissection plane between rectum and urethra revealed the thick wall characteristic of absent-vagina cases 20:28. The team now faced a choice: use the mobilized rectum as rectum and create a neovagina from sigmoid colon, or convert the rectum itself into a neovagina and accept sigmoid colon functioning as rectum.

Cystoscopy confirmed normal urethra and bladder. Diagnostic laparoscopy revealed a uterus, fallopian tubes, ovaries, and a rudimentary upper vaginal structure ending blindly near the bladder. The upper vagina appeared to connect to what might be cervical tissue, though this could not be definitively confirmed intraoperatively.

The room debated. One consultant noted that sigmoid colon lacks the storage capacity and physiologic properties of rectum 28:50. Another pointed out that in a series of eight similar cases, only one had an imperforate hymen; the rest had no uterus or fallopian tubes 28:50. In this case, Müllerian structures were present, raising the question of future fertility.

An audience poll returned 98% in favor of preserving the rectum as rectum 69:37. The surgeon agreed: "That's what God made it into" [q10].

Management

The team proceeded with rectal pull-through and sigmoid colon neovagina creation. A 7-to-8-centimeter segment of sigmoid colon was harvested on its left colic pedicle 65:08. Sigmoid was chosen over small bowel for its more robust blood supply 59:42. The staple line was removed to avoid leaving foreign material in the neovaginal lumen 49:17.

The neovagina was connected to the rudimentary upper vaginal structure based on tactile assessment suggesting cervical tissue. Because the neovagina was tethered to this upper structure, no additional fixation to pelvic fascia or posterior bladder was required to prevent prolapse 68:53. The anoplasty was completed with electrical nerve stimulation — using the anesthesia train-of-four device rather than a dedicated perineal stimulator 7:47 — to map the sphincter complex. A colo-colonic anastomosis restored bowel continuity.

The timing was deliberate. Creating the neovagina during the initial rectal mobilization avoided operating later through a scarred perineum 48:12. "I think that would be a mistake," the surgeon said. "We're here. It's an ideal time to do this" 48:12.

Regarding the uterus: without a confirmed cervix, retaining it carried risk of pyometra with no proven fertility benefit 44:03. No live births have been reported from uteri with congenital cervical agenesis connected to neovagina 44:03. The decision was made to leave the uterus in place for now, recognizing that future technology — uterine transplantation was mentioned — might change the calculus. "I don't know what's going to happen with our technology," the surgeon said [q12].

Outcome and Follow-Up

Postoperative pain management included patient-controlled analgesia 86:40. The plan called for pelvic ultrasound and vaginoscopy after breast budding to assess for a functional cervix and monitor for hematometra 70:40. Vaginal dilation would not be routinely performed, though some patients require minor revision for introital stenosis 69:37. If recurrent infection developed, laparoscopic removal of the uterus would be considered.

Vaginal agenesis in perineal fistula occurs approximately once per 500 cases 44:03. MRI has limited utility for visualizing the vaginal lumen in infants unless hydrocolpos or hematocolpos is present 82:15. In a case this rare, the preoperative workup would not have changed. "I don't think we would have changed the preoperative workup," the surgeon reflected [q13]. The discovery was intraoperative, and the response was real-time multidisciplinary consultation.

The transferable judgment: when anatomy deviates this far from expectation, the goal is not to force a predetermined plan but to preserve options — for continence, for sexual function, and for fertility technologies that do not yet exist.
